Optimizing the equity reassignment process: A novel application for family businesses
1Universidad Adolfo Ibáñez, Facultad de Ingeniería y Ciencias, Santiago, Chile.
This study introduces an optimization model to aid complex equity reassignment in family business conglomerates. The model helps owners navigate preferences and costs, facilitating conflict resolution and informed decision-making.
Area of Science:
- Business and Economics
- Finance
- Operations Research
Background:
- Family businesses face unique challenges in equity reassignment due to complexity and owner-specific needs.
- Existing research often overlooks the intricate process of ownership restructuring within family conglomerates.
- Resolving equity distribution is crucial for preventing family disputes and ensuring business continuity.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op and present an optimization model for equitable ownership reassignment in large family business conglomerates.
- To support decision-making by incorporating diverse owner preferences, financial constraints, and risk diversification.
- To provide a framework for analyzing the financial implications of different reassignment requirements.
Main Methods:
- A novel optimization model was designed to determine optimal equity reassignment based on owner preferences.
- The model accounts for equity and loan distribution, liquidity, capital structure, transaction costs, and risk diversification.
- Post-optimal analysis was incorporated to provide insights into the cost of incorporating specific requirements.
Main Results:
- The model was successfully applied to a real-world case involving a family holding with 4 members and 26 companies.
- An initial optimal solution was identified, which, after post-optimal analysis, facilitated owner consensus on the final equity distribution.
- The methodology proved effective in navigating complex ownership structures and diverse stakeholder needs.
Conclusions:
- This research pioneers the use of optimization models for family business ownership reassignment.
- It uniquely integrates portfolio optimization, corporate finance, and family business dynamics.
- The study offers a valuable tool for resolving complex equity distribution issues and mitigating family conflicts.
